    While we are down there is anyone interested in a trip to the Udvar Hazy Center? For anyone who doesn’t know it is an extension of the Smithsonian Air and Space museum and it is full of Aviation history including Military, Civilian/Commercial, and Space. Parking is $15 per vehicle but admission to the center is free.

    The yard sale is very popular, there will be a lot of sellers and a lot of shoppers. But I’ve bought little and never had a table, so I don’t know what kind of business you can expect to do.

    I can’t find the Yard Sale information on the BrickFair site, does anybody know where it is? I can’t see where to sign up either, which means there may have been a deadline that has passed, or it is full. Unless the rules have changed, though, it’s a flat rate per table, and everything you have for sale has to fit on the table.

    You can find the information if you go to the schedule and click on ‘Yard Sale Thursday’. It is $10 for 1/2 table and $20 for whole table. You cannot sign up until after you have checked in to the event.
